1 / 113
文档名称:

PHP教学大纲.docx

格式:docx   大小:2,260KB   页数:113页
下载后只包含 1 个 DOCX 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

PHP教学大纲.docx

上传人:分享精品 2017/8/7 文件大小:2.21 MB

下载得到文件列表

PHP教学大纲.docx

相关文档

文档介绍

文档介绍:《PHP基础》理论教学大纲
开课院(部):工程学院
撰写时间:2015年5月
课程名称:PHP基础
课程所属层面: ①公共基础②学科基础③专业知识④工作技能
课程性质:①必修②限选③任选
课堂讲授学时:32
实践学时:64
总学时:96
总学分:6
周学时:6
开课学期:第3学期
一、课程目的与要求
《PHP程序设计基础教程》是面向计算机相关专业的一门专业Web开发课程,面向对象编程、HTTP、会话技术、文件编程等内容,通过本课程的学****学生能够了解 PHP语言的特点、面向对象程序设计思想,学会利用 PHP 语言开发简单的Web项目。为进一步学****相关课程打下基础,为学生软件开发方向的就业做知识储备。
二、与其它相关学科的衔接
本课程是一门重要的专业必修课,也是一门实践性很强的课程。是在有C语言操作基础上进一步学****开发语言,学生要先完成《SQL数据库技术》、《C程序设计》等课程后再开设本课程。
三、教学内容及要求
第一章 PHP开篇
本章教学目标与要求:熟悉PHP语言的特点,掌握PHP开发环境的搭建。通过学****学生可以了解PHP程序的工作流程,并可以编写、运行简单的PHP程序。
本章重点:PHP环境搭建、Apache配置
本章难点:PHP程序的工作流程。
本章内容:
第一节 PHP基础知识
1、web技术
2、PHP概述
3、常用编辑工具
第二节 PHP开发环境搭建
1、Apache的安装
2、Apache的配置
3、PHP的安装
第三节编写Hello World程序
复****思考题:
熟悉PHP的开发环境,编写并运行Hello World程序。
第二章 PHP基本语法
本章教学目标与要求:熟悉PHP的语法风格;掌握基本语法;掌握常量和变量的使用;掌握流程控制语句的使用;掌握各种运算符。
本章重点:变量$的用法;数据类型,类型转换;流程控制语法for,while,if,switch。
本章难点:流程控制的执行流程;各种运算符的运算规则;常量的定义与操作。
本章内容:
第一节 PHP语法风格
1、PHP标记
(1)标准标记
(2)短标记。
(3)ASP标记。
(4)Script标记。
2、PHP注释
第二节 PHP标识符与关键字
1、PHP标识符
2、PHP关键字
第三节 PHP常量
1、常量的定义
2、预定义常量
第四节 PHP变量
1、变量的定义
2、PHP的数据类型
(1)Boolean布尔型
(2)integer整型
(3)float浮点型
(4)string字符串型
3、检测变量的数据类型
4、可变变量
第五节变量类型的转换
1、自动类型转换
(1)转换成布尔型
(2)转换成整型
(3)转换成字符串型
2、强制类型转换
第六节 PHP运算符
1、运算符和表达式
2、算数运算符
3、赋值运算符
4、递增递减运算符
(1)递增递减数字
(2)递增递减字符
(3)递增递减布尔值或NULL
5、比较运算符
6、逻辑运算符
7、位运算符
8、错误控制运算符
9、运算符的优先级
第七节流程控制语句
1、选择结构语句
(1)if语句
(2)if…else语句
(3)if…elseif…else语句
(4)switch… case语句
2、循环结构语句
(1)while语句
(2)do…while语句
(3)for循环语句
3、跳转语句
(1)break语句
(2)continue语句
(3)goto语句
复****思考题:
完成经典****题星星塔。
第三章函数
本章教学目标与要求:掌握函数的定义及调用;掌握调用带有默认值,或引用传递的函数的方法;掌握可变函数的使用;了解常用的预定义函数的使用。
本章重点:定义调用;参数的默认值,参数引用传递;常用函数以及函数的嵌套调用。
本章难点:递归调用、静态局部变量、可变函数。
本章内容:
第一节初识函数
1、函数的定义
2、函数的调用
3、函数的返回值
第二节函数的高级应用
1、函数中变量的作用域
2、可变函数
3、函数的嵌套调用
第三节函数的递归调用
第四节字符串相关函数
1、explode()函数:按照某种规则对字符串进行分割。
2、implode()函数:将字符数组拼接成一个新的字符串。
3、strcmp()函数:对两个字符串进行比较操作。
4、str_replace()函数:对字符串中的某些字符进行替换操作。
5、substr()函数:截取一个字符串中的某一部分。
6、strlen()函数:统计字符串的长度。
7、trim()函数:过滤字符串中的空白字符。
第五节日期和